Efficiency, accessibility, and responsiveness can all be improved by integrating artificial intelligence (AI) into public services, as has long been claimed. Modern AI has opened up new opportunities for governments around the world, especially with the introduction of Large Language Models (LLMs) like Google’s Gemini and ChatGPT. The models in question have conversational capabilities akin to those of a human being, with the ability to address a wide range of inquiries pertaining to public information, legal advice, benefits, taxes, and other government services.

However, the journey towards implementing AI in government is fraught with challenges and ethical considerations. Colin van Noordt, a researcher specializing in AI applications in government based in the Netherlands, points out the historical evolution of chatbots. Early iterations were simpler, with limited conversational abilities. The emergence of generative AI in the past two years, powered by LLMs, represents a leap forward in capability. These models, trained on vast datasets, can theoretically handle a wide array of queries, offering responses that mimic human speech patterns and understanding.

Yet, the allure of generative AI is tempered by significant drawbacks. One of the primary concerns is accuracy and reliability. Despite their sophisticated training, LLMs are prone to errors and inconsistencies, sometimes generating nonsensical responses or misinformation. In the United Kingdom, for instance, the Government Digital Service (GDS) conducted trials with ChatGPT-based chatbots under the GOV.UK Chat initiative. While generally useful, the system occasionally provided incorrect information, highlighting the challenge of ensuring factual accuracy in critical government interactions.

Sven Nyholm, a professor of AI ethics at Munich’s Ludwig Maximilians University, raises profound ethical questions regarding the deployment of AI in public administration. Unlike human civil servants who can be held accountable for their actions, AI chatbots lack moral agency and cannot bear responsibility for errors or decisions that may adversely affect citizens. This accountability gap is significant in contexts where transparency, fairness, and trust are paramount, such as legal advice or sensitive government services.

Moreover, Nyholm underscores the limitations of AI in understanding context and nuance. While LLMs can simulate intelligence and creativity to some extent, they often struggle with complex queries that require deep comprehension or subjective judgment. This limitation poses a challenge in scenarios where precise and contextually sensitive responses are essential.

Despite these challenges, governments continue to explore the potential benefits of AI-driven services. China, for instance, has made significant strides in adopting generative AI technologies. According to a survey by U.S. AI and analytics software company SAS and Coleman Parkes Research, 83% of Chinese respondents reported using generative AI in various industries, surpassing global averages significantly. This rapid adoption underscores China’s commitment to leveraging AI for technological leadership and economic competitiveness.

With its Bürokratt chatbots, Estonia presents an interesting alternate strategy to other countries that have adopted LLMs extensively. Since the early 1990s, Estonia has led the way in the development of digital government services, being a pioneer in the creation of complete e-government platforms and digital IDs. With a concentration on Natural Language Processing (NLP) as opposed to LLMs, Bürokratt is a representation of Estonia’s customized approach to AI in public services.

NLP operates differently from LLMs by breaking down user queries into structured components, identifying key words, and inferring intent based on predefined rules and datasets. This approach prioritizes reliability and accuracy, emphasizing factual information over conversational flair. Kai Kallas, head of the Personal Services Department at Estonia’s Information System Authority, explains Bürokratt’s operational model. When faced with queries beyond its capabilities, Bürokratt seamlessly transfers the interaction to human customer support agents, ensuring that users receive accurate responses without compromising on quality.

The Bürokratt project underscores Estonia’s commitment to transparency and user trust. Unlike LLMs, which often operate as black-box systems with opaque decision-making processes, NLP-based chatbots offer greater visibility into their operation. This transparency is crucial in public administration, where accountability and reliability are essential for fostering public trust in digital government services.

Nevertheless, NLP-based systems like Bürokratt are not without limitations. While they excel in providing structured and reliable information, they may lack the conversational depth and creativity of LLMs. Estonia acknowledges this trade-off but prioritizes accuracy and user confidence in its approach to AI-driven public services.

Looking ahead, the global landscape of AI in government services remains dynamic and complex. Governments must navigate technological advancements while addressing ethical concerns and ensuring equitable access to AI-driven services. The debate over the role of AI chatbots versus human interaction continues to evolve, with proponents advocating for AI’s potential to streamline operations and improve service delivery, while skeptics emphasize the irreplaceable value of human judgment and accountability.

Even though ChatGPT and other LLMs have great opportunities to improve government services through AI, user trust, accuracy, and accountability must all be carefully considered when implementing them. An alternate use of NLP that emphasizes dependability and openness in the provision of digital services is demonstrated by Bürokratt in Estonia. Realizing the full potential of AI in public administration would need governments around the world to find a balance between ethical governance and innovation in AI technologies.
